Anti-Uncoupling protein 1 antibodies are directed against the protein encoded by the gene UCP1 in humans. The gene may also be known as UCP, SLC25A7, mitochondrial brown fat uncoupling protein 1, and solute carrier family 25 member 7. Structurally, the protein is reported to be 33 kilodaltons in mass. Based on gene name, canine, porcine, monkey, mouse and rat orthologs may also be found.
